This Marrakech Fez tour 5 days via Erg Chebbi desert takes you first into the High Atlas mountains. You cross the scenic Tizi n’Tichka pass – the highest major road in North Africa at 2,260 meters. The landscape shifts quickly during the journey: from olive groves and plains to terraced fields and stone Berber villages carved into the mountains.

You’ll stop along the way for panoramic views, local argan oil cooperatives, and a traditional mountain lunch. By midday, this Morocco tour from Marrakech brings you to Aït Ben Haddou, the most famous ksar in the South. This clay-brick fortress, protected by UNESCO, looks frozen in time. It has starred in Gladiator, Game of Thrones, and countless epics. Take your time wandering its ancient alleys, climbing to the top for sweeping views of the Ounila Valley with a local guide.

In the afternoon, this desert tour to Fez goes through Ouarzazate, home to Atlas film studios and the striking Kasbah Taourirt. Then this Morocco trip continues East toward the Dades Valley, where red cliffs and winding roads lead you to a charming guesthouse. Enjoy a traditional home made Moroccan dinner and spend the night in a peaceful place.

Start the second day of this Marrakech Fez desert tour with a breakfast in Dades. Then hit the road through the Dades Gorge, where strange rock formations—like the famous « Monkey Fingers » – create an impressive, otherworldly backdrop. From here, this Marrakech desert tour to Fez continues to the Todra Gorge, a deep canyon carved by centuries of flowing water. Towering limestone walls close in around you, reaching up to 300 meters. Walk alongside the river and admire this natural wonder up close.

On the way to Erfoud, the terrain flattens as you approach the Sahara. The tour goes through Erfoud, known for its date palms and fossil workshops. You stop here for lunch before reaching Merzouga – the gateway to the famous Erg Chebbi dunes.

In the afternoon, this Marrakech Sahara desert tour makes you enjoy a gentle ride into the golden sand of Erg Chebbi. The silence here is absolute. As the sun dips below the dunes, the Sahara turns gold, and then pink. By nightfall, you’ll arrive at a Merzouga desert camp with private tents. After a traditional dinner, gather around the campfire for music, storytelling, and star watching.

Wake early to catch the Sahara sunrise—a magical, humbling moment that paints the dunes in fire and shadow. After breakfast in the Merzouga desert camp, you’ll spend the day of this Marrakech to Fez tour, discovering Erg Chebbi and the Sahara.

Today’s 4×4 desert tour takes you to the village of Khamlia, home to a community of Black Moroccan Gnawa musicians originally descended from West African slaves. Their trance-like rhythms and spiritual songs are central to desert culture. You’ll also visit nomadic Berber families still living in traditional tents, stop at fossil quarries, and explore palm-fringed oases hidden behind dunes.

In the afternoon, choose how to spend your time:

  • Sandboard on the dunes,
  • Explore the nearby lake (in season) by 4×4,
  • Take an optional quad or buggy ride through the desert ;

As the sun sets again, return to the Erg Chebbi desert camp for the night.

After a slow breakfast, say goodbye to the desert and begin your journey North. This Sahara desert excursion from Marrakech to Fez follows the lush Ziz Valley, where a ribbon of green palms winds through the rocky mountains for over 100 km. It’s a beautiful contrast after the sands of Merzouga.

You will pass Berber villages and ksour (fortified villages), stopping for scenic views and local crafts. Around midday, you’ll arrive in Rich, where you will stop for lunch.

After this break, this Marrakech Fez tour continues to Midelt, a quiet town between the High and Middle Atlas ranges. Known for apples, carpets, and cool mountain air, it’s a peaceful place to spend the night and break up the long drive to Fez.

Settle into a warm, welcoming riad and enjoy dinner with views of the peaks surrounding the town.

On your final day, this Morocco Marrakech tour to Fez weaves through the Middle Atlas mountains, passing cedar forests, highland lakes, and grazing sheep. Stop in the Azrou forest to look for Barbary macaques, the only native monkeys in Morocco.

Next, visit Ifrane, one of the cleanest cities in Africa and the most surprising stop of this 5 days Morocco tour. With its alpine-style architecture, red-roofed homes, and snow in winter, it looks more Swiss than Moroccan. It’s a favorite getaway for Moroccan families – and a great place to grab coffee before the final stretch to Fez.

By late afternoon, you’ll arrive in Fez, Morocco’s oldest imperial city and the end of your journey.
